Metroon brings Windows 8 to iOS devices

Bookmark and Share

Microsoft’s Windows 8 Metro interface is being eagerly waited for, but the Redmond firm will not release it before late October.

However, Metroon, a Dreamboard theme for Apple’s jailbroken iOS devices, is offering a near-perfect replica of Microsoft’s Metro interface for those who cannot wait for the software any more.

The Dreamboard theme includes a Windows Phone OS-like fully equipped lock screen. It features notifications and volume controls, along with a swipe up to unlock feature. When a user activates Metroon it works in a similar way to Windows 8 Start Screen, and presents a launcher for applications with live tiles providing information on applications at a glance.

Users can pin all their iOS applications to the Metroon Start Screen, plus there is even a Charms bar that comes into appearance when the user swipe from the right-hand side of the screen of his/her iPhone or iPod Touch.

A desktop tile brings the familiar iOS home screen, while the Charms bar brings the user back into the Metro interface that is almost identical to Windows 8 OS’ desktop mode.

Overall Metroon’s Dreamboard theme for jailbroken iOS devices is impressively great, but the combination of a mixed mode of Metro and the default iOS notifications sometimes makes it confusing.

Metroon for iOS devices can be had from the Cydia store for $1.50.
